All Abigail Riley wants is love and a better life. Whether it's in 2015 or 1941, only she can decide.
When eighteen-year-old Abigail, just free of the foster care system, finds a mysterious old box in the room she rents in New Hampshire, she's given the opportunity to travel to the past. When her curiosity supersedes her skepticism, she follows the instructions in the box and is brought to the year 1941, two months before the attack on Pearl Harbor.
It is here that she discovers a sense of belonging, a key to the past, and love for the first time. 
She is introduced to Charlie Bridgeport who is incredibly charming and sees beauty in Abigail that she doesn't see in herself. They are quick to fall in love and Abigail is convinced that Charlie is too good to be true. He is. Charlie is a newly enlisted Sailor who is reporting for duty soon on the USS Oklahoma in Pearl Harbor. Powerless to warn Charlie of his impending doom, Abigail may be left to mourn the only person to ever love her.
When she unexpectedly returns to 2015, Abigail finds herself torn between her feelings for Charlie and her new best friend, Chase Chastain. Two very different guys living in two very different time periods. Now Abigail must decide if her future lies in the past or the present.
